Output eb04f66a0e9be9ec70bfaf8b070c14753dd3fbf54c6779f19e1025e049542c20:12

value
17308612
script pubkey
OP_0 OP_PUSHBYTES_20 3b93ac6d822e398ad0697a2bc5479f2f3c912b5a
address
bc1q8wf6cmvz9cuc45rf0g4u23ul9u7fz2668nnvcc
transaction
eb04f66a0e9be9ec70bfaf8b070c14753dd3fbf54c6779f19e1025e049542c20
confirmations
233966
spent
true